如何在Outlook中導入和導出類別?

如你所知,你可以 在Outlook中創建許多顏色類別。 此外,您還可以導出所有自定義類別並與同事共享,或導入到新計算機中,等等。本文旨在引導您完成Microsoft Outlook中的導出和導入類別。

箭頭藍色右氣泡從Microsoft Outlook導出類別

可以從Microsoft Outlook導出所有顏色類別,包括默認類別和自定義類別。 您可以按照以下步驟進行操作:

步驟1:建立新筆記:

  • 在Outlook 2007中,請點擊 文件 > 全新 > 備註.
  • 在Outlook 2010中,請點擊 新產品 > 更多項目 > 備註.

步驟2:在新的筆記對話框中,輸入一些文本。 在這種情況下,我們輸入 分類.

第3步:在“註釋”窗口中,單擊左上角的按鈕,然後單擊 保存並關閉 在Outlook 2010中(或 關閉 在Outlook 2007中)。

步驟4:點擊 備註 導航窗格中的圖標。

步驟5:單擊之前創建的註釋,然後單擊 分類 > 所有類別 ,在 標籤 組上 首頁 標籤在Outlook 2010中。

在Outlook 2007中,單擊 分類 > 所有類別 在工具欄中。

步驟6:在“顏色類別”對話框中,檢查稍後將導出的顏色類別,然後單擊 OK 按鈕。

步驟7:將註釋拖放到Windows文件夾中以保存它。 此註釋將另存為.msg文件。


箭頭藍色右氣泡將類別導入Microsoft Outlook

在將顏色類別導入Microsoft Outlook之前,需要一個帶有顏色類別的.msg註釋文件。

步驟1:點擊 備註 在導航窗格中。

步驟2:將帶有顏色類別的便箋.msg文件拖到Microsoft Outlook中。

第3步:點擊轉到郵件視圖 郵件 在導航窗格中。

第3步:在導航窗格中右鍵單擊一個電子郵件帳戶名稱,然後選擇 數據文件屬性 在右鍵菜單中。

步驟4:在“文件夾屬性”對話框中,單擊 升級到顏色類別 按鈕。

第5步:出現警告對話框,只需點擊 按鈕。

然後,將註釋的.msg文件中添加的所有顏色類別複製並導入到Microsoft Outlook中。

步驟6:點擊 OK 文件夾屬性對話框中的按鈕。

注意:
1.如果您的電子郵件帳戶類型是不支持註釋的SMTP(例如Gmail),則此技巧不可用。
2.僅當粘貼的便箋和電子郵件文件夾屬於pst或ost的相同數據文件時,才能更新顏色類別。
